Supergoop! City Serum is a lightweight, anti-aging morning lotion that offers SPF 30 PA+++ protection while hydrating and improving skin health. Infused with antioxidant-rich Vitamins E and B5, this non-greasy formula is perfect for daily use, especially for men seeking a smooth and radiant complexion.

For reference:I have combination skin, oily forehead, nose and chin, dry everywhere else.27 Year old Mexican with tan skin (might not seem like necessary information to know, but light skin tones differ so much from darker ones!)I had been using Glossier Invisible Shield for a little over a year, although I thought it was a great product, I Was never convinced by it, I had ordered it because I saw on a Snapchat story and it claimed to be the hottest release of the year.. anyways, I continued purchasing it because it was good enough for what I needed it to do, even though I hated the container it came in, might sound silly, but the pump was weird, you can’t really press down on it, so when you press down the product that comes out is not nearly enough to cover your entire face, you have to press multiple times. I recently decided that I needed to take better care of my face, so I went on a search for a new sun screen. After a few online articles of which are the best sunscreens (and why), this product came up on all of them.. so I figured I would give it a try. It’s only been a week, but I am in love with it! It has virtually no smell, it goes on smooth and clear. I included some pictures, the product on my hand on the left is the glossier, I was towards the end of the bottle, and it always got super runny towards the end, which was not good for my oily zones, as they would feel/look extra oily. The product on the right is the Supergoop! Yes, the product is white, but it is smoothed over the skin it becomes clear, and it does not leave a white residue like Neutrogena’s does. Price wise, Glossier runs at $25 for one ounce, and supergoop at $21 for an ounce ($42 for two ounces), so a little bit cheaper if price is a concern, but since you use less of the supergoop material, it will last lo geek, the container is then replaced less, so to me, it has considerable savings. Hope this helps anyone, sorry if its long, my husband and I rely a lot on consumer reviews, so we alwsys appreciate a thoughtful review!*update*: the bottle lasted me a LONG time, every day use, sometimes more if I went to the pool, and only recently did I have to buy a replacement.

I live in Florida and need sunscreen everyday. I like most of Supergoop's products but I do find their facial sunscreens to have a chemical smell, which is why I was skeptical of using this product. Overall it's fairly lightweight and easy to put on in the morning. I have normal skin and usually by late afternoon, my face tends to feel greasy, which I haven't experienced with other sunscreen serums/moisturizers (Paula's choice, Peter Thomas Roth). Smell is minimal but one thing I dislike about this is despite using it daily, the hole where the product is dispensed, always seems to have a little clog, so product clumps up. When I dispense it on my hand, I always have to pick it out. Overall, product is decent but I probably won't buy again given the cost. I'll stick to my other brands I prefer.
